語言 :
SWEWE 會員 :登錄 |註冊
搜索
百科社區 |百科問答 |提交問題 |詞彙知識 |上傳知識
上一頁 2 下一頁 選擇頁數

控件

一般是指幫助軟件實現圖像瀏覽與簡單編輯功能的控件。

代表:ImagXpress、Image Uploader、leadtools等。

文檔處理控件

一般指實現文檔文件的瀏覽、編輯功能的控件。

代表:add-in express for office and vcl、Aspose、TX Text Control等。

庫類控件

由Microsoft 基礎類庫(MFC) 提供的其他控件類(以前稱為OLE 控件),可以在Windows 應用程序的對話框中使用,或在萬維網的HTML 頁中使用。有關更多信息,請參見MFC ActiveX 控件。公共控件

Windows 操作系統總是提供了若干Windows 公共控件。這些控件對像都是可編程的,Visual C 對話框編輯器支持將這些控件對象添加到對話框。 Microsoft 基礎類庫(MFC) 提供相應的類來封裝這些控件中的每一個,如表Windows 公共控件和MFC 類中所示。 (表中的某些項有進一步描述它們的相關主題。有關沒有主題的控件的信息,請參見MFC 類的文檔。)

CWnd 類是所有窗口類(包括所有控件類)的基類。下列環境支持 Windows 公共控件:

Windows 95、Windows 98 和 Windows 2000。

Windows NT 3.51版及更高版本。

Win32 系列1.3 版(Visual C 4.2 版及更高版本不支持Win32 系列)。

舊式公共控件在Windows 的早期版本中同樣可用,這些舊式公共控件包括複選框、組合框、編輯框、列錶框、選項按鈕、普通按鈕。

應用示例

列錶框示例

要在Microsoft Office Excel 2003 和早期版本的Excel 中添加列錶框,請單擊“窗體”工具欄上的“列錶框”按鈕。然後,創建包含單元格B2:E10 的列錶框。如果未顯示“窗體”工具欄,請指向“視圖”菜單上的“工具欄”,然後單擊“窗體”。要在Excel 2007 中添加列錶框,請依次單擊“開發工具”選項卡、“插入”,然後單擊“窗體控件”部分中的“列錶框”。右鍵單擊列錶框,然後單擊“設置控件格式”。鍵入以下信息,然後單擊“確定”。要指定列表的區域,請在“數據源區域”框中鍵入H1:H20。要在單元格G1 中鍵入數值(根據在列表中選擇的項目),請在“單元格鏈接”框中鍵入G1。注意:INDEX() 公式使用G1 中的值返回相應的列表項目。在“選定類型”下,確保選擇“單選”選項。單擊“確定”。注意:僅在您使用Microsoft Visual Basic for Applications 過程返回列表值時,“複選”和“擴展”選項才有用。另請注意,使用“三維陰影”複選框可使列錶框具有三維外觀。列錶框應顯示項目列表。要使用列錶框,請單擊任意單元格,這樣不會選擇列錶框。如果您單擊列表中的某一項目,單元格G1 將更新為一個數字,以指示所選項目在列表中的位置。單元格A1 中的INDEX 公式使用此數字顯示項目的名稱。

組合框示例

要在Excel 2003 和早期版本的Excel 中添加組合框,請單擊“窗體”工具欄上的“組合框”按鈕。要在Excel 2007 中添加組合框,請依次單擊“開發工具”選項卡、“插入”,然後單擊“窗體控件”部分中的“組合框”。創建包含單元格 B2:E2 的對象。右鍵單擊組合框,然後單擊“設置控件格式”。輸入以下信息,然後單擊“確定”: 要指定列表的區域,請在“數據源區域”框中鍵入H1:H20。要在單元格G1 中鍵入數值(根據在列表中選擇的項目),請在“單元格鏈接”框中鍵入G1。注意:INDEX 公式使用G1 中的值返回相應的列表項目。在“下拉顯示項數”框中,鍵入 10。此條目決定在必須使用滾動條查看其他項目之前顯示的項目數。注意:“三維陰影”複選框是可選的;使用它可使下拉框或組合框具有三維外觀。下拉框或組合框應顯示項目列表。要使用下拉框或組合框,請單擊任意單元格,這樣不會選擇對象。如果您單擊下拉框或組合框中的某一項目,單元格G1 將更新為一個數字,以指示所選項目在列表中的位置。單元格A1 中的INDEX 公式使用此數字顯示項目的名稱。

微調框示例

要在Excel 2003 和早期版本的Excel 中添加微調框,請單擊“窗體”工具欄上的“微調框”按鈕,然後創建包含單元格B2:B3 的微調框。將微調框的大小調整為大約列寬度的四分之一。要在Excel 2007 中添加微調框,請依次單擊“開發工具”選項卡、“插入”,然後單擊“窗體控件”部分中的“數值調節鈕”。右鍵單擊微調框,然後單擊“設置控件格式”。輸入以下信息,然後單擊“確定”: 在“當前值”框中,鍵入1。此值將初始化微調框,以便INDEX 公式指向列表中的第一個項目。在“最小值”框中,鍵入 1。此值會將微調框的頂部限制為列表中的第一個項目。在“最大值”框中,鍵入 20。 此數字指定列表中條目的最大數。在“步長”框中,鍵入 1。此值控制微調框控件將當前值增大多少。要在單元格G1 中鍵入數值(根據在列表中選擇的項目),請在“單元格鏈接”框中鍵入G1。單擊任意單元格,這樣不會選擇微調框。如果您單擊微調框中的向上控件或向下控件,單元格G1 將更新為一個數字,以指示微調框的當前值與微調框步長的和或差。然後,此數字將更新單元格A1 中的INDEX 公式以顯示下一項目或上一項目。如果您在當前值為1 時單擊向下控件,或者在當前值為20 時單擊向上控件,則微調框值不會更改。

滾動條示例

要在Excel 2003 和早期版本的Excel 中添加滾動條,請單擊“窗體”工具欄上的“滾動條”按鈕,然後創建高度為單元格B2:B6 且寬度大約為列寬度的四分之一的滾動條。要在Excel 2007 中添加滾動條,請依次單擊“開發工具”選項卡、“插入”,然後單擊“窗體控件”部分中的“滾動條”。右鍵單擊滾動條,然後單擊“設置控件格式”。鍵入以下信息,然後單擊“確定”。在“當前值”框中,鍵入 1。此值將初始化滾動條,以便INDEX 公式指向列表中的第一個項目。在“最小值”框中,鍵入 1。此值會將滾動條的頂部限制為列表中的第一個項目。在“最大值”框中,鍵入 20。此數字指定列表中條目的最大數。在“步長”框中,鍵入 1。此值控制滾動條控件將當前值增大多少。在“頁步長”框中,鍵入 5。此條目控制當您單擊滾動條中滾動框的任意一邊時將當前值增大多少。要在單元格G1 中鍵入數值(根據在列表中選擇的項目),請在“單元格鏈接”框中鍵入G1。注意:“三維陰影”複選框是可選的;使用它可使滾動條具有三維外觀。單擊任意單元格,這樣不會選擇滾動條。如果您單擊滾動條中的向上控件或向下控件,單元格G1 將更新為一個數字,以指示滾動條的當前值與滾動條步長的和或差。此數字在單元格A1 中的INDEX 公式中使用,以顯示當前項目的下一項目或上一項目。您還可以拖動滾動條以更改值,或單擊滾動條中滾動框的任意一邊以將該值增大5(“頁步長”值)。如果您在當前值為1 時單擊向下控件,或者在當前值為20 時單擊向上控件,則滾動條不會更改。

其他控件

除了封裝所有Windows 公共控件的類和支持對您自己的ActiveX 控件進行編程(或使用其他應用程序提供的ActiveX 控件)的類以外,MFC 本身還提供了下列控件類:

CBitmapButton

CCheckListBox

CDragListBox

控件{Controls}:一種基於微軟公司ActiveX技術的可重用的軟件組件。可用這些組件增加網頁、桌面應用程序和軟件開發工具的交互性以及更多的功能,例如動畫效果或彈出式選單。 ActiveX控件可用不同程序設計語言編寫,包括Java、C 和Visual Basic。


上一頁 2 下一頁 選擇頁數
用戶 評論
還沒有評論
我要評論 [遊客 (3.128.*.*) | 登錄 ]

語言 :
| 校驗代碼 :


搜索

版权申明 | 隐私权政策 | 版權 @2018 世界百科知識